Coding challenge: a sliding window map

import java.util.concurrent.DelayQueue | |
import java.util.concurrent.Delayed | |
import java.util.concurrent.TimeUnit | |
class SlidingWindowMap { | |
private periodMs | |
private available = new DelayQueue<DelayedKey<String>>() | |
SlidingWindowMap(Set<String> keys, int maxCount, long periodMs) { | |
this.periodMs = periodMs | |
keys.each { key -> maxCount.times { available << new DelayedKey<String>(payload: key) } } | |
} | |
/** | |
* @return a key that has been used less than `maxCount` times during the | |
* past `periodMs` milliseconds or null if no such key exists. | |
*/ | |
String getNextKey() { | |
def delayedKey = available.poll() | |
if (delayedKey) available << delayedKey.blockFor(periodMs) | |
return delayedKey?.payload | |
} | |
} | |
class DelayedKey<T> implements Delayed { | |
T payload | |
long targetTimestamp | |
long getDelay(TimeUnit unit) { unit.convert(targetTimestamp - System.currentTimeMillis(), TimeUnit.MILLISECONDS) } | |
int compareTo(Delayed o) { getDelay(TimeUnit.MILLISECONDS) <=> o.getDelay(TimeUnit.MILLISECONDS) } | |
DelayedKey<T> blockFor(long delayMs) { | |
targetTimestamp=System.currentTimeMillis() + delayMs | |
return this | |
} | |
} | |
